Sorry, we did not find any results for:
closest chinese restaurant delivery to me
Make sure all words are spelled correctly.
Try different keywords.
Try more general keywords.
Try fewer keywords.
Related searches
closest chinese restaurant delivery near me
nearest chinese restaurant delivery near me
nearest chinese restaurant to me delivery
closest chinese restaurant to me open now delivery
closest chinese restaurant to me that delivers
closest chinese delivery to me
About us
Copyright
Disclaimer
Privacy policy
End user license agreement
Sitemap